Tilting chair-back spring mounting mechanism
➶ How it works
A wire spring with two limbs coils around the arms of a spider-frame beneath the seat and extends backward, twisting together into a loop that engages a forked standard supporting the chair back. A pivot bolt passes through the forked standard and the spring loop, allowing the back to tilt independently of the seat, while a set-screw compresses the fork members onto the loop to fix the tilt angle. A separate adjusting bar and set-screw at the front ends of the spring vary the spring's tension, controlling the resistance of the tilting back.
➶ What was claimed
“The seat and back supports and the spring comprising two members twisted together and formed into a loop whereby it is connected to the back-support, said back-support having a forked end to receive the loop, and a set-screw to compress the fork members upon the loop, substantially as described.”
In plain English: A chair where the seat and back are joined by a two-part twisted wire spring forming a loop that fits into a forked back support, held in place by a set-screw that clamps the fork onto the loop.
➶ In the inventor’s words
“I am aware that coiled springs have been combined with tilting seats and with a tension-regulating screw, and such device is not herein claimed.”— Smith N. McCloud, from the specification

Patent 622,062 covers a spring mounting for a tilting chair back, assigned to the Davis Chair Company of Marysville, Ohio, and it has nothing to do with ducks, geese, turkeys, or anything else you'd whisper at from a blind. That said, since it's here, McCloud's mechanism is a tidy bit of wire-forming. The spring isn't a separate coil bolted between seat and back — it's a single two-limb wire that coils around the arms of the spider-frame under the seat, then twists together into a loop that becomes the pivot for the forked back-standard. The spring is the hinge. A set-screw clamps the fork onto the loop to lock the tilt, and a front adjusting bar varies tension. His own disclaimer is telling: coiled springs with tension screws were old news by 1899, so his claim rests narrowly on the twisted-loop-in-fork detail.
